3. HVAC Technician Training Course Content and Certification

πŸ“Œ Course Content:

  • HVAC System Basics: Principles of heating, ventilation, and air conditioning
  • Equipment Installation and Maintenance: Residential and commercial HVAC system maintenance
  • Refrigerant Handling: Obtain EPA 608 certification
  • Electrical Systems and Troubleshooting: Improve repair skills

πŸ“Œ HVAC Certification Online:

  • EPA 608: Refrigerant handling certification (online exam available)
  • NATE: Industry HVAC technical certification (some courses available online)
  • OSHA: Workplace safety certification (online exam available)

5.What Does an HVAC Technician Do?

During your HVAC technician training or apprenticeship, you'll gain hands-on experience and develop essential skills to ensure the comfort and safety of homes, schools, hospitals, and commercial buildings:

βœ… Install, maintain, and repair heating, ventilation, and air conditioning systems, ensuring reliable temperature control year-round. βœ… Troubleshoot and fix issues in refrigeration and ventilation equipment, keeping systems running efficiently in all conditions. βœ… Perform preventive maintenance to extend the life of HVAC systems and reduce the risk of unexpected breakdowns. βœ… Use a wide range of professional tools and diagnostic devices, including pressure gauges, electrical testers, and refrigerant recovery systems. βœ… Work under the guidance of experienced HVAC technicians or mentors, learning to read blueprints, wiring diagrams, and complete real-world installation and service tasks. βœ… Earn industry-recognized certifications such as EPA 608 or NATE, setting the foundation for a high-paying and stable career.
